lights

英 [laɪts]

美 [laɪts]

n.  光; 光线; 光亮; (具有某种颜色和特性的)光; 发光体; 光源; (尤指)电灯
v.  点燃; 点火; 开始燃烧; 燃起来; 照亮; 使明亮
light的第三人称单数和复数

双语例句

  • The search lights and the fireworks made the sky a kaleidoscope of colour.
    探照灯和焰火使得天空的颜色千变万化。
  • Lights clipped onto life jackets improve the chances of rescue
    别在救生衣上的灯提高了获救可能性。
  • She took the needle off the record and turned the lights out.
    她把唱针从唱片上移开,把灯也关了。
  • Some fog warning signs had been put up with flashing yellow lights.
    一些配有黄色闪光灯的大雾警示标志立了起来。
  • Fluorescent lights flickered, and then the room was brilliantly, blindingly bright
    荧光灯闪了几下,接着屋子里豁然大亮,刺得人睁不开眼。
  • Neon lights gleamed in the deepening mists.
    霓虹灯在渐浓的雾霭中隐约闪烁。
  • The lights of the car lit up a signpost
    车灯照亮了路标。
  • A few scattered lights shone on the horizon.
    地平线上闪耀着几处星星点点的灯光。
  • Nancy left the shades down and the lights off.
    南希放下窗帘,关了灯。
  • As the water came in the windows, all the lights went off.
    随着水从窗子漫进来,灯全部熄灭了。
